15 September 2026: Week Begins with Slight Decline Amid Market Weakness
Infinity Infoway Ltd opened the week at Rs.534.00 on 15 Sep 2026, registering a decline of 0.84% from the previous close. This drop occurred in the context of a broader market sell-off, with the Sensex falling 1.69% to 35,169.62. The stock’s volume was moderate at 2,400 shares, reflecting cautious investor sentiment. Despite the negative start, the stock’s relative outperformance versus the Sensex’s sharper decline suggested underlying resilience.
16 September 2026: New 52-Week and All-Time Highs Spark Optimism
On 16 Sep 2026, Infinity Infoway Ltd surged to a new 52-week and all-time high of Rs.545.00, closing the day with a 2.06% gain. This marked a significant technical milestone, as the stock outperformed the Sensex, which rose by only 0.30% to 35,276.25. The price advance was supported by a 3.89% outperformance relative to its sector, signalling renewed investor interest. The stock traded above all major moving averages, including the 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day averages, underscoring strong technical momentum.
Fundamentally, this price action coincided with the release of robust financial results. Infinity Infoway Ltd reported net sales growth of 220.19% and a profit after tax increase of 275.81% for the six months ending June 2026. The company’s valuation metrics reflected a growth orientation, with a trailing twelve months P/E ratio of 37 times and a price-to-book value of 6.96 times. These figures indicate that the market is pricing in strong earnings growth and operational efficiency.
Quality assessments highlighted a very strong return on capital employed (ROCE) of 43.59%, low leverage, and no promoter share pledging, supporting financial stability. Delivery volumes also rose significantly, with a 92.31% increase over the trailing one-month period, suggesting growing investor participation.

17 September 2026: Minor Correction Despite Broader Market Gains
Following the strong rally, Infinity Infoway Ltd experienced a slight pullback on 17 Sep 2026, closing at Rs.542.00, down 0.55% from the previous day. This minor decline came amid a positive market environment, with the Sensex advancing 0.46% to 35,439.31. The stock’s volume increased to 2,000 shares, indicating active trading despite the price dip. The pullback may reflect short-term consolidation after the recent surge to all-time highs, with the stock remaining well supported above key moving averages.
18 September 2026: Week Ends with Modest Gain and Steady Momentum
Infinity Infoway Ltd closed the week on 18 Sep 2026 at Rs.543.00, up 0.18% on the day with a volume of 1,200 shares. The Sensex continued its upward trend, gaining 0.52% to 35,625.23. The stock’s weekly performance of +0.84% contrasted favourably with the Sensex’s weekly decline of 0.41%, highlighting the company’s relative strength. Technical indicators remain mildly bullish, with the stock trading near its recent highs and supported by positive volume trends.
| Date | Stock Price | Day Change | Sensex | Day Change |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2026-09-15 | Rs.534.00 | -0.84% | 35,169.62 | -1.69% |
| 2026-09-16 | Rs.545.00 | +2.06% | 35,276.25 | +0.30% |
| 2026-09-17 | Rs.542.00 | -0.55% | 35,439.31 | +0.46% |
| 2026-09-18 | Rs.543.00 | +0.18% | 35,625.23 | +0.52% |
Key Takeaways from the Week
Positive Signals: Infinity Infoway Ltd demonstrated resilience by outperforming the Sensex with a weekly gain of 0.84% against the benchmark’s 0.41% decline. The stock’s new 52-week and all-time high of Rs.545 on 16 Sep was supported by strong financial results, including a 220.19% increase in net sales and a 275.81% rise in profit after tax for the six months ending June 2026. Technical indicators such as MACD and KST remain bullish, and the stock trades comfortably above all major moving averages.
Cautionary Signals: Despite the strong rally, the stock experienced a minor pullback on 17 Sep, indicating short-term consolidation. The MarketsMOJO rating was downgraded to Hold with a Mojo Score of 64.0 on 15 Sep, reflecting a more cautious fundamental outlook. Valuation multiples remain elevated, with a P/E ratio of 37 times and EV/EBITDA of 27.88 times, suggesting that the market is pricing in high growth expectations which may limit near-term upside.

Conclusion
Infinity Infoway Ltd’s performance during the week of 14 to 18 September 2026 was characterised by a notable technical milestone and solid financial growth, culminating in a new 52-week and all-time high of Rs.545. The stock’s ability to outperform the Sensex amid a mixed market environment underscores its relative strength and investor interest. While the recent downgrade to a Hold rating signals caution on fundamentals, the company’s robust sales and profit growth, coupled with strong capital efficiency and low leverage, provide a sound operational foundation. Investors should monitor the stock’s consolidation patterns and valuation levels as it navigates the current phase of momentum.
